Distance From Valladolid Airport to Marco Polo Airport (VLL - VCE Distance)
The flight distance from Valladolid Airport (VLL) to Marco Polo Airport (VCE) is 898 miles. This is equivalent to 1445 kilometers or 780 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.
1445 kilometers is the distance from Valladolid Airport, Spain to Marco Polo Airport, Italy.
Flight Duration between Valladolid, Spain and Venice, Italy
Estimated flight time from Valladolid Airport, Valladolid, Spain to Marco Polo Airport, Venice, Italy is 1 hours 47 minutes under avarage conditions. The flight time calculator assumes an average flight speed for a commercial airliner of 500 mph, which is equivalent to 805 km/hr or 434 knots. Your actual flying time may vary depending on wind speeds or weather conditions.
